Anything not posted to "junk" goes to a mailing list. The
GMaNe model is "treat all lists like moderated newsgroups",
the list-address is the "moderator" at this step, standard
operation for moderated newsgroups.
If the list accepts the submitted mail GMaNe gets it back,
does some mail2news magic about X-Posts and References if
only In-Reply-To is available, and finally it appears in
the newsgroup corresponding to the list.

It's one way how moderated newsgroups can work: Take article,
add MAIL FROM server, RCPT TO moderator, send. The moderator
adds "Approved" and injects it into NetNews. Or forwards it
to next moderator for X-Posts in more than one moderated NG.
Or rejecets it. USEPRO will propose a better procedure with
a MIME type, but for obvious reasons GMaNe would stick to the
old procedure, mailing lists are not really moderated NGs. ;-)
